Bookkeeper

Location: Cebu
Work Arrangement: Onsite, Fulltime
Shift: 9:00PM - 6:00AM | Monday - Friday

Unlock your potential! At TOA Global, we have a deep commitment to empowering individuals to excel in their enterprises, careers, and communities. Our global footprint stretches across Australia, New Zealand, North America, and Philippines, supporting our global clients in the accounting industry.

About this role. . .

We are currently seeking a full-time Bookkeeper to join our team. This role supports multiple small business and individual clients and requires strong attention to detail, organization, and accountability.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Record transactions, reconcile accounts, and maintain general ledgers in QuickBooks Desktop (QBD) for multiple client accounts
  • Prepare financial reports for assigned small business and individual clients
  • Run client payroll, submit payroll tax payments, and prepare and file federal and state payroll tax forms
  • Prepare and file sales and use tax returns, including processing related payments
  • Complete simple to intermediate individual income tax returns using TaxWise with limited oversight
  • Manage multiple client engagements while meeting deadlines and maintaining strong organization
  • Work professionally in an in-office public accounting environment and maintain accountability for assigned work

Qualifications / Skills:

  • Experience preparing individual income tax returns
  • Familiarity with TaxWise or similar tax preparation software
  • Prior experience in a public accounting or CPA firm environment
  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field
  • Experience in bookkeeping and maintaining accurate general ledgers
  • Strong proficiency with QuickBooks Desktop (QBD)
  • Experience running payroll and handling payroll tax payments and filings
  • Experience preparing and filing sales and use tax returns
  • Solid understanding of financial statements and accounting principles
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
  • Ability to manage multiple clients and work independently with minimal supervision
